Remembering legendary actor Manna on his birth anniversary

Today marks the birth anniversary of late legendary actor Aslam Talukder Manna. Born on April 14, 1964, in Kaitla village of Kalihati, Tangail, Manna made his silver screen debut in 1984 through the BFDC-organised talent hunt programme, “Notun Mukher Shondhane”. His first released film was “Pagli”.

Thousands gather at Ramna Batamul to welcome Bengali New Year

Thousands of Bangalees ushered in Bengali Year 1432 at Ramna Batamul on Monday morning, as Chhayanaut’s iconic Pahela Baishakh celebration marked its 58th edition with renewed hope, harmony, and heritage.

Chhayanaut ushers in 1432 at Ramna Batamul with Raag Bhairav

As the sun rose over Dhaka, Chhayanaut’s Pahela Baishakh celebration for the Bengali year 1432 began at Ramna Batamul. The theme of Chhayanaut's Pahela Baishakh celebration this year is "Amar Mukti Aloy Aloy" (my freedom lies in light). Through this theme, Chhayanaut aims to convey a message of hope, resilience, and renewal.

Eid films oust Hollywood releases at Star Cineplex

This Eid-ul-Fitr, the overwhelming popularity of Bangladeshi films has led Star Cineplex to halt screenings of Hollywood blockbusters at its branches nationwide. Initially, the multiplex scheduled local and international films, hoping to offer a diverse cinematic experience. However, due to the overwhelming demand for domestic productions, the organisation has shifted its focus entirely toward Bangladeshi releases.

‘Taylor Swift: The Eras Tour’ director to helm ‘The Bodyguard’ remake

Warner Bros is moving forward with a remake of “The Bodyguard”, with director Sam Wrench attached to helm the project. Wrench previously directed the hugely successful concert film “Taylor Swift: The Eras Tour”. The screenplay will be written by Jonathan Abrams, who made his feature writing debut with Clint Eastwood’s legal drama “Juror #2”, which premiered last fall. Casting for the remake has not yet been finalized.
